FileVault destroys data


FileVault destroys data 11/05/2003 10:59 AM
FileVault, the new encryption feature in Panther designed to protect data, instead seems to detroy it. According to Macworkd UK, users have reported that FileVault has caused repeated corruption of data from Safari, Address Book, Mail, Keychain and the Dock. There have also been reports of Keychains being reset and then failing to store new passwords. The issue has ben reported to spread to other machines when users synchronize multiple computers using their .Mac accounts. Apple is aware of...

Data Recycler 1.3 updates Panther
support, more


Data Recycler 1.3 updates Panther
support, more
06/24/2004 04:16 PM
Prosoft Engineering announced on Thursday the release of an upgrade to its deleted file recovery tool Data Recycler X. Version 1.3 repairs compatibility problems with Mac OS X v10.3.3 and adds several new features, including the addition of Path and Owner columns to the file browser; a security change to the operating system's cache that renames files and keeps them in a flat hierarchy, so that "smart" installers can't find them; support for users with relocated home directories; bug fixes; and more. This is a free update for registered users while new users can download a demo from the Prosoft Web site. Data Recycler is US$49 and requires Mac OS X v10.1.5 or higher.

FireWire 400 data loss culprit remains a
mystery


FireWire 400 data loss culprit remains a
mystery
11/05/2003 08:16 PM
Apple Computer Inc. said last week that t hey had identified an issue with the Oxford Semiconductor 922 chipset used in FireWire 800 hard drives and were working to fix the issue. While Apple, Oxford and hard drive manufacturers have stated the issue only affects the newer Oxford 922 chips, users of FireWire 400 drives have been reporting symptoms very similar to the ones initially found with FireWire 800.

FileVault + iMovie = Trouble


FileVault + iMovie = Trouble 02/10/2004 02:56 AM
I was trying to import some video I shot at the beach into iMovie and it just wouldn’t go; the picture would lurch and stutter and then the import would just halt, no diagnostics. I was puzzled because I used to import all the time on my much-slower previous PowerBook. Then I remembered that I’d turned on FileVault, i.e. everything in my home directory is encrypted. I wouldn’t be surprised if soaking up data at FireWire rates, plus encrypting it, might be a bit much; so I logged into another—unencrypted—account on this computer and it imported fine. So I may be jumping to conclusions, but this looks like a bad combination.
